Metacognition in Action: Empowering Students to Think While They Read
Description
In this engaging and research-based presentation, we will explore the power of metacognition in literacy instruction. Metacognition—thinking about one’s thinking—is the key to transforming students from passive readers into active, engaged thinkers. We'll discuss practical strategies for fostering metacognitive awareness, equipping students with tools to monitor their comprehension, and empowering them to take ownership of their reading journey. Attendees will walk away with actionable insights to help students develop critical thinking skills, enhance comprehension, and build confidence as independent readers. Get ready to shift your approach to reading instruction and cultivate Thinking Readers in your classroom!
